Solution for 20r^2+r=12 equation:


Simplifying
20r2 + r = 12

Reorder the terms:
r + 20r2 = 12

Solving
r + 20r2 = 12

Solving for variable 'r'.

Reorder the terms:
-12 + r + 20r2 = 12 + -12

Combine like terms: 12 + -12 = 0
-12 + r + 20r2 = 0

Factor a trinomial.
(-4 + -5r)(3 + -4r) = 0

Subproblem 1

Set the factor '(-4 + -5r)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ying -4 + -5r = 0 Solving -4 + -5r = 0 Move all terms containing r to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'4' to each side of the equation. -4 + 4 + -5r = 0 + 4 Combine like terms: -4 + 4 = 0 0 + -5r = 0 + 4 -5r = 0 + 4 Combine like terms: 0 + 4 = 4 -5r = 4 Divide each side by '-5'. r = -0.8 Simplifying r = -0.8

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(3 + -4r)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 3 + -4r = 0 Solving 3 + -4r = 0 Move all terms containing r to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3' to each side of the equation. 3 + -3 + -4r =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0 0 + -4r = 0 + -3 -4r =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 0 + -3 = -3 -4r = -3 Divide each side by '-4'. r = 0.75 Simplifying r = 0.75

Solution

r = {-0.8, 0.75}
